Why Do People Give Compliments?

Compliments are one of the simplest ways people express appreciation, admiration, or encouragement. Sometimes they’re meant to brighten someone’s day, while other times they’re used to start a conversation or show romantic interest. Understanding the reason behind a compliment helps you choose the most appropriate response.

To Show Appreciation

People often compliment others because they genuinely admire something about them, whether it’s their personality, appearance, effort, or achievements.

To Flirt

Compliments are a common way to show attraction. A playful or funny reply can keep the conversation exciting without making things awkward.

To Encourage Someone

A compliment can boost confidence, especially when someone has worked hard or is feeling uncertain. Responding with gratitude shows you value their kindness.

To Start a Conversation

Sometimes a compliment is simply an icebreaker. A humorous response can make the interaction more memorable and help the conversation flow naturally.

To Build Relationships

Giving sincere compliments helps strengthen friendships, family bonds, and romantic relationships. Responding warmly encourages positive communication and mutual respect.

When You Should Keep It Simple Instead

There are times when a sincere “thank you” is a much better choice than a joke.

Professional Settings

If a manager, client, or business partner compliments you, respond professionally and express genuine appreciation.

Job Interviews

Interviewers often compliment your experience or answers to make you feel comfortable. A polite thank you is the safest and most professional response.

Teachers

When a teacher compliments your work or progress, acknowledge their encouragement respectfully instead of making jokes.

Elderly Relatives

Older family members may not understand sarcastic or trendy humor. A warm and appreciative response is usually the better option.

Serious Conversations

If someone offers a heartfelt compliment during an emotional moment, avoid humor that might take attention away from what they’re expressing.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

One of the biggest mistakes people make is trying too hard to be funny. If a joke feels forced, it can make the conversation awkward instead of enjoyable.

Another common mistake is sounding arrogant. There’s a fine line between playful confidence and bragging. Make sure your humor feels light rather than self centered.

Avoid offensive jokes or sarcasm that could hurt someone’s feelings. The goal is to make both people smile, not create discomfort.

It’s also important to pay attention to why the compliment was given. If someone sincerely praises your work, kindness, or achievements, showing genuine appreciation is often more meaningful than trying to make a joke.

Finally, don’t overuse funny responses. Sometimes a simple “Thank you, I really appreciate that” is the most memorable reply of all.

Expert Tips for Accepting Compliments Gracefully

Receiving a compliment with confidence doesn’t mean you have to become the funniest person in the room. The best responses balance humor with appreciation. If someone takes the time to say something kind, acknowledge it first before adding a playful joke.

Smile if you’re talking face to face, or use a lighthearted tone in text messages. Your delivery matters just as much as your words. A funny response should make the other person feel good about giving the compliment, not make them regret it.

It’s also important to read the room. Friends may love sarcastic jokes, while coworkers or professional contacts usually appreciate sincerity. If you’re unsure, keep your humor gentle and avoid anything that could be misunderstood.

Most importantly, don’t feel pressured to be funny every time. Sometimes the most confident response is simply saying, “Thank you, that means a lot.”
